Hi, Have just moved from BT to EE (had to due to contract with BT ending). Do I cancel my direct debit with BT or do EE just take it over? Thanks,

There wont be any need to cancel the BT direct debit, once the final BT bill is produced when the BT account is closed, any final payments or refunds due will use the direct debit and then the BT direct debit will just stop.

The EE direct debit will have been set up when ordering. If you already have the EE SIM you can setup your EE online account and once logged in can view and manage the EE direct debit  on the website. Here you can view the direct debit date and change if needed. You can also text BILL to 150 from the EE SIM and it will confirm the EE bill date.
